Just for the record, my E3276 does appear to support the ^NDISSTATQRY? command.
Franko, I am still not clear on why you object to using ^NDISDUP with this 
modem.

ATI
Manufacturer: huawei
Model: E3276
Revision: 21.192.13.00.00
IMEI: 86378101*******
+GCAP: +CGSM,+DS,+ES

OK
AT^NDISDUP=?
^NDISDUP: (1-20),(0-1)

OK
AT^DHCP?

ERROR
AT^NDISSTATQRY?
^NDISSTATQRY: 0,,,"IPV4"

OK

AT^NDISDUP=1,1

OK

^NDISSTAT:1,,,"IPV4"
AT^DHCP?
^DHCP: 53B3729,FCFFFFFF,63B3729,63B3729,1D173029,3D173029,43200000,43200000

OK
AT^NDISSTATQRY?
^NDISSTATQRY: 1,,,"IPV4"

OK
AT^NDISDUP=1,0

OK

^NDISSTAT:0,,,"IPV4"
AT^DHCP?

ERROR
AT^NDISSTATQRY?
^NDISSTATQRY: 0,,,"IPV4"
